  • Patent number: 5527847
    Abstract: Plasticizers are homogeneously incorporated into finely divided solid polyamides by mechanically agitating a mixture of plasticizers and polyamides at temperatures of at least 80.degree. C. while the polyamide remains in the finely divided solid phase.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: January 13, 1994
    Date of Patent: June 18, 1996
    Assignee: Huels Aktiengesellschaft
    Inventors: Salih Mumcu, Weigand Kramer, Wolfgang Kriesten, Hans J. Panoch

  • Patent number: 3966838
    Abstract: Polyamide base powder coating material from a polyamide having an average of about 8 - 11 aliphatic carbon atoms per carbonamide group and containing about 0.2 to 5 percent by weight of carbonamide groups having n-alkoxymethyl groups based on the total number of carbonamide groups and about 0.01 - 2 percent by weight of acid catalysts.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: April 24, 1973
    Date of Patent: June 29, 1976
    Assignee: Chemische Werke Huls Aktiengesellschaft
    Inventors: Rainer Feldmann, Wolfgang Kriesten, Karl Adolf Muller, Hans Joachim Panoch, Heinz Scholten
